Directions

Step 1

Prepare the Filling: In a small saucepan, combine the diced mango, passion fruit pulp, honey, and lime juice. Cook over medium heat for about 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the mixture starts to thicken.

Step 2

Thicken the Filling: In a separate bowl, mix the cornstarch with the water to create a slurry. Slowly add the slurry to the fruit mixture while stirring. Continue cooking for another 2-3 minutes until the mixture is thickened to a custard-like consistency. Remove from heat and let cool slightly.

Step 3

Prepare the Tart Shells: While the filling cools, preheat your oven according to the package instructions for the tart shells. If using homemade shells, prepare them and bake according to your recipe. If using store-bought mini tart shells, simply place them on a baking sheet.

Step 4

Fill the Tarts: Spoon the passion fruit and mango mixture into the cooled mini tart shells, filling them generously but leaving a small border around the edges.

Step 5

Bake (If Needed): If your tart shells require baking (check the instructions on the package), bake according to the directions until the crust is golden brown.

Step 6

Cool and Serve: Allow the tarts to cool completely before serving. Garnish with fresh mint leaves for a pop of color and an extra touch of freshness.

Pro Tips for Perfect Mini Tarts

  • Use Fresh Mango: Fresh mango will give you the best flavor and smoothest filling. If using frozen, make sure it’s fully thawed and drained.
  • Chill the Tarts: Be sure to refrigerate the tarts for at least an hour to let the filling set properly.
  • Pre-made Shells for Convenience: While you can make your own tart shells, using store-bought mini shells saves time and effort, perfect for when you’re in a hurry.
  • Tart Topper: Feel free to adjust the amount of passion fruit pulp you use based on your preference for tanginess. You can even use other fruits, like kiwi or raspberry, for variety.

FAQs

  1. Can I use frozen mango?
    Yes! Frozen mango works well, just make sure it’s thawed and drained before blending for the smoothest texture.
  2. Can I make the tarts ahead of time?
    Yes! These tarts can be made a day in advance and stored in the fridge. The crust may soften slightly, but the flavor will still be amazing.
  3. Can I substitute the passion fruit pulp?
    If you can’t find passion fruit, you can use any tangy fruit topping like fresh lime curd, raspberry puree, or even a dollop of lemon curd.
  4. How do I store leftovers?
    Store any leftover tarts in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. The filling may become a little more firm the longer it sits.

Creative Variations

  • Berry Bliss: Add a layer of fresh berries (like blueberries or raspberries) between the mango filling and passion fruit topping for extra color and flavor.
  • Tropical Coconut: Top the tarts with shredded coconut for a more tropical flair, or incorporate coconut milk into the filling for a creamy, coconut-infused flavor.
  • Citrus Twist: Add a bit of lime zest to the mango filling or mix in orange zest to create a more citrusy taste.
